It will take a large amount of genetic diversity to completely render these vaccines useless. These mutations have not been able to alter the S protein’s shape to the extent that the vaccine-induced antibodies provided by these vaccines are not able to bind at all.
Remember these vaccines (especially these using the whole spike protein) make polyclonal antibody responses. This means that the antibodies created will be able to bind the Coronavirus’ spike in multiple places not just one. Hence a broader range of protection even with changes.
We have many tools to prevent the virus from spreading. Physical barriers (masks), social distancing, and proper hand hygiene. We also have effective vaccines that need to be used immediately. We want and need more protected people and fewer susceptible people. Simple as that.
If the virus doesn’t spread it doesn’t mutate. It needs us, as a host, and our cells to do this. If we don’t give it that, it can’t spread nor mutate. With the vaccines, if the neutralizing activity of vaccine sera goes down too much the vaccines can be replaced and modified.
